five journeys to cloud - oracle...five journeys to cloud infrastructure • conservative to...
TRANSCRIPT
Copyright © 2016 Oracle and/or its affiliates. All rights reserved. |
Five Journeys to CloudHow to build Enterprise Cloud Strategy for Data Driven Business
Yvan CognasseOracle EMEA & APAC Cloud Enterprise Architect
Copyright © 2016 Oracle and/or its affiliates. All rights reserved. |
Safe Harbor Statement
The following is intended to outline our general product direction. It is intended for information purposes only, and may not be incorporated into any contract. It is not a commitment to deliver any material, code, or functionality, and should not be relied upon in making purchasing decisions. The development, release, and timing of any features or functionality described for Oracle’s products remains at the sole discretion of Oracle.
2
Copyright © 2016 Oracle and/or its affiliates. All rights reserved. | 3
Complete. Open. Choice. Secure.
Bringing Cloud Agility to Enterprise Application Landscape
SaaS
PaaS
IaaS
• Integrated SaaS
• PaaS designed for enterprise applications
• IaaS designed for enterprise applications
• On-premises, off-premises or public cloud model on-premises
Off-PremisesOn-Premises
Copyright © 2016 Oracle and/or its affiliates. All rights reserved. |
Five Journeys to Cloud Infrastructure
• Conservative to aggressive options as appropriate
• Portions of IT portfolio may dictate different approaches
• Single architecture, different consumption options
Streamline Enterprise
On-Premises
Lift & Shift to Public
Cloud
DeployHybrid Cloud
ExtendPrivate Cloud
Bring Public Cloud
On-Premises
Copyright © 2016 Oracle and/or its affiliates. All rights reserved. | Oracle Confidential--Internal Use Only 5
You Need Dramatic Results, But Cloud Isn’t Imminent
Goals:
• Substantially improve on-premises enterprise application infrastructure
• Show dramatic cost savings
• Have compatible cloud options should they be needed
Streamline Enterprise
On-Premises
Copyright © 2016 Oracle and/or its affiliates. All rights reserved. |
Today’s Complex, Enterprise On-Premises EnvironmentRequires Larger and Larger Staff to Manage
6
Streamline Enterprise
On-Premises
Copyright © 2016 Oracle and/or its affiliates. All rights reserved. |
Exact Cloud Equivalents Should Need AriseCloud insurance enables you to move forward today with confidence
Oracle Confidential--Internal Use Only 7
X S P Z
Database Tier Application Tier Big Data and Analytics Data Protection
B X
Streamline Enterprise
On-Premises
Copyright © 2016 Oracle and/or its affiliates. All rights reserved. | Oracle Confidential--Internal Use Only 8
Your Current Private Cloud Model Doesn’t Support All Enterprise Apps
Goals:
• Extend private cloud model: optimized for enterprise applications
• Deliver additional private cloud benefits: pooling, automation and self-service consumption
• Have compatible public cloud options
ExtendPrivate Cloud
Copyright © 2016 Oracle and/or its affiliates. All rights reserved. |
X
9
Example: Create Database-as-a-Service with Oracle Exadata, Oracle Private Cloud Appliance
Database-as-a-Service
Generic Private Cloud Enterprise Apps Private Cloud
ExtendPrivate Cloud
Copyright © 2016 Oracle and/or its affiliates. All rights reserved. | 10
Unify Enterprise Applications on Private Cloud:Database, Applications and Analytics
X
Database-as-a-Service
Applications-as-a-Service
P
Generic Private Cloud Enterprise Apps Private Cloud
ExtendPrivate Cloud
Copyright © 2016 Oracle and/or its affiliates. All rights reserved. | Oracle Confidential--Internal Use Only 11
Implement Hybrid Cloud for Development and Testing
Goals:
• Show cost savings and agility
• Move to variable cost model
• Speed developer productivity
• Validate hybrid cloud model
• Minimize complexity
DeployHybrid Cloud
Copyright © 2016 Oracle and/or its affiliates. All rights reserved. |
Typical Development/Test Environment
12
Assembled Application Develop Environment
Dev/Test Infrastructure
• Resources must be provisioned in advance
• Delivers poor utilization over lifespan
• Development and deployment infrastructures have meaningful differences
• Impact: Inefficient and unproductive
Production Infrastructure
DeployHybrid Cloud
Copyright © 2016 Oracle and/or its affiliates. All rights reserved. |
Hybrid Cloud Development/Test Environment
13
Engineered Application Development Environment
• Resources provisioned on-demand
• Identical development and deployment infrastructure
• Delivers excellent utilization
• More efficient and more productive
Production Infrastructure
X PDev/Test/QA
PaaS
Caching
Database
Integration
Java EE Java SE Node
Messaging
X P
Same Standards
Same Products
Unified ManagementDeployHybrid Cloud
Copyright © 2016 Oracle and/or its affiliates. All rights reserved. | Oracle Confidential--Internal Use Only 14
Public Cloud Model Looks Attractive, But Can’t Be Used
Goals:
• Bring public cloud model to the data center
• Use modern tools to evolve enterprise applications
• Drive cost transparency
• Support Oracle and non-Oracle software
• Maintain required controlBring Public
Cloud On-Premises
Copyright © 2016 Oracle and/or its affiliates. All rights reserved. |
Data Centers and Public Clouds: Two Different Worlds
15
Traditional Data Center Model
• Static and inflexible• Antiquated tools• Capital intensive• Labor intensive
IaaS
PaaSCaching
Database Node
Java EE
Integration
Java SE Messaging
Network Storage Compute
Public Cloud Model
• Dynamic and flexible• Modern tools• Pay-as-you-go transparency• Automated and efficient
Bring Public Cloud
On-Premises
Copyright © 2016 Oracle and/or its affiliates. All rights reserved. |
Bring Public Cloud Model To Your Data CenterOracle Cloud Machine speeds app development inside your firewall
16
Public Cloud Model
• Dynamic and flexible• Modern tools• Pay-as-you-go transparency• Automated and efficient
IaaS
PaaSCaching
Database Node
Java EE
Integration
Java SE Messaging
Network Storage Compute
Public Cloud Model on Premises
• Dynamic and flexible• Modern tools• Pay-as-you-go transparency• Automated and efficient
IaaS
PaaSCaching
Database Node
Java EE
Integration
Java SE Messaging
Network Storage Compute
Bring Public Cloud
On-Premises
Copyright © 2016 Oracle and/or its affiliates. All rights reserved. |
Extended Cloud Model On-Premises and OffSame architecture gives you choice were to develop, deploy
17
Public Cloud Model
IaaS
PaaSCaching
Database Node
Java EE
Integration
Java SE Messaging
Network Storage Compute
Public Cloud Model on Premises
IaaS
PaaSCaching
Database Node
Java EE
Integration
Java SE Messaging
Network Storage Compute
• Dynamic and flexible• Modern tools• Pay-as-you-go transparency• Automated and efficient
• Dynamic and flexible• Modern tools• Pay-as-you-go transparency• Automated and efficient
Same Standards
Same Products
Unified ManagementBring Public
Cloud On-Premises
Copyright © 2016 Oracle and/or its affiliates. All rights reserved. | Oracle Confidential--Internal Use Only 18
Immediate Need to Move Workloads to Public Cloud
Goals:
• Maintain current predictability, manageability and control
• Source relevant skills migrating, managing workloads once in the cloud
• Overcome significant “technical debt”
Lift & Shift to Public
Cloud
Copyright © 2016 Oracle and/or its affiliates. All rights reserved. | 19
Identify App Candidate to Lift-and-Shift to Cloud
Lift & Shift to Public
Cloud
Copyright © 2016 Oracle and/or its affiliates. All rights reserved. | 20
Oracle Services Migrates to Oracle Public CloudComplete planning, migration, validation, training operational staff
Lift & Shift to Public
Cloud
Copyright © 2016 Oracle and/or its affiliates. All rights reserved. |
Oracle Helps You NavigateThrough Cloud Transition
Streamline Enterprise
On-Premises
Lift & Shift to Public
Cloud
DeployHybrid Cloud
ExtendPrivate Cloud
Bring Public Cloud
On-Premises
On-Premises
Cloud at Customer
Public Cloud
• Choose from three cloud deployment models
• Use for any or all of the five journeys to the cloud
• Get a single-vendor on-premises-to-cloud integrated experience
• Have cloud insurance and long-term investment protection
22Oracle Confidential – Internal Use Only